    NDS CycloDS Evolution Supports MicroSDHC

    News from Team Cyclops

    Today heralds the unveiling of CycloDS Evolution’s surprise hardware feature – support for MicroSDHC memory cards!

    MicroSDHC (SD High Capacity) is the new standard for compact flash memory cards which offers far greater capacity than traditional MicroSD memory cards. Whilst the maximum capacity supported by traditional MicroSD is a mere 2gigabytes, MicroSDHC supports up to a mammoth 32gigabytes. CycloDS Evolution breaks the memory capacity barrier by being first NDS flash cart to implement support for MicroSDHC cards. Furthermore, MicroSDHC cards are not backwards compatible so any device not designed specifically to support MicroSDHC will not be able to take advantage of these new high capacity cards.
